Thyroid cartilage cyst is not a serious disease, the cyst itself is a benign lesion, if the cyst is particularly small, there is usually no clinical discomfort symptoms, but when the cyst increases in size is likely to appear local mass or appear corresponding pressure, which will cause a series of uncomfortable symptoms, such as likely to appear poor breathing or local swelling and pain, infection is likely to appear local redness, swelling, pain. In case of infection, local redness, swelling and pain may occur. If the cyst is large, surgery can be considered to remove it. If the cyst is not very large, it can be temporarily observed, usually do not regularly stimulate it, must be appropriate to increase exercise, to avoid anxiety on fire.
